In the commercial and industrial sectors, fly ash has a wide variety of applications and uses, though it is primarily known for … Web1 day ago · Atis [7] reported that sand can be replaced with fly ash up to 30% with w/c ratio of 0.6. They observed that the strength with fly ash concrete increase with increase in the curing days. They reported that strength of the concrete with 30% fly ash as sand replacement showed higher strength than reference concrete at 126 days. WebIn the United States, fly ash is generally stored at coal power plants or placed in landfills. About 43% is recycled, [5] often used as a pozzolan to produce hydraulic cement or hydraulic plaster and a replacement or partial replacement for Portland cement in … how essential is sleep
